Understanding Static Electricity and Its Issues

First off, we need to understand what static electricity is and why it's a problem. Static electricity builds up when there's an imbalance of electric charges on the surface of an object. This can happen through processes like friction, induction, or conduction. In industrial settings, static electricity can cause all sorts of headaches. It can attract dust and debris to products, causing contamination. In some cases, it can even lead to electrical shocks, which can be a safety hazard for workers. And let's not forget about the potential for static discharge to damage sensitive electronic components.

How Corona Generators Work

Now, let's talk about how corona generators, including our Hanging Style Corona Generator, work. A corona generator creates a corona discharge. This is a type of electrical discharge that occurs when a high voltage is applied to a conductor, causing the air around it to ionize. When the air is ionized, it contains a mix of positive and negative ions.

The basic principle behind using a corona generator for static elimination is to introduce these ions into the environment where static electricity is a problem. The ions will then neutralize the static charges on the surface of objects. If an object has a positive static charge, negative ions from the corona discharge will be attracted to it, and vice versa.

Limitations and Considerations

Of course, no solution is perfect. The Hanging Style Corona Generator does have some limitations. As mentioned earlier, the distance between the generator and the target objects is critical. Also, the ambient conditions can affect its performance. High humidity, for example, can make it more challenging to maintain a stable corona discharge and can reduce the effectiveness of static elimination.
